To process your raw CAN or LIN data, you will typically need a DBC file (CAN database). This file contains information on how to decode the raw CAN data and extract relevant CAN signals like temperatures, engine speed etc. A couple of scenarios exist when it comes to DBC files: the range slogan

WebThis DBC file editor is a purely client-side tool. This means that your DBC file is not uploaded to some backend server for processing - everything is done directly via your browser, using Javascript/HTML/CSS only. In other words, you can use the editor freely online also for sensitive DBC files.
